Let’s explore why changing your brand name on Amazon listings can be a strategic move and how to navigate this process seamlessly.
Brand Evolution: As businesses grow and expand, they may outgrow their original brand names or need to reposition themselves in the market. Whether it’s due to a merger, rebranding efforts, or simply a desire to better reflect the company’s ethos, a name change can signal a new chapter for the brand.
Keyword Optimization: Updating your brand name on Amazon listings allows you to optimize for relevant keywords, improving discoverability and search ranking. By incorporating strategic keywords into your new brand name, you can attract more potential customers and increase visibility within the Amazon ecosystem.
Consistency Across Channels: Maintaining consistency across all online platforms is essential for brand integrity. When customers encounter your brand on Amazon, they should have the same experience as they would on your website or social media channels. Updating your brand name ensures cohesion and reinforces brand recognition.
Customer Trust: A transparent approach to rebranding instills trust and confidence in your customers. Clearly communicate the reasons behind the name change and reassure customers that the quality and integrity of your products remain unchanged. Open communication fosters loyalty and strengthens customer relationships.
Navigating the Process: Changing your brand name on Amazon listings requires careful planning and execution. Begin by updating your seller account information with Amazon Seller Central. Update product listings, storefronts, and any other relevant content to reflect the new brand name. Monitor customer feedback and address any questions or concerns promptly.
